From Auburn loss to Week 2, Lagway expected to miss Baylor game

Baylor quarterback DJ Lagway is not expected to play against Prairie View A&M because of an ankle injury.

Baylor quarterback DJ Lagway is expected to miss the Bears’ Week 2 game against Prairie View A&M while recovering from an ankle injury suffered against Auburn, according to a report from Pete Thamel. It is not yet clear whether Lagway will dress or be available in a limited role.

Nate Bennett is expected to make his first career start for Baylor in Lagway’s place. Bennett has been in the program for several years and has seen limited action as a backup, according to the report.

Lagway played through the injury against Auburn and finished with 333 yards and two touchdowns. Baylor lost after a potential game-winning two-point conversion attempt came up short.

The expected absence would give Lagway additional time to recover before continuing his first season at Baylor. He transferred from Florida after two seasons there, including a 2025 campaign in which he went 4-8 as a starter. He also led Florida to a win over Texas and had a five-interception game against LSU.

Baylor’s schedule after Prairie View A&M includes a game against Louisiana Tech. The Bears are not scheduled to face a currently ranked opponent until a mid-November matchup with BYU, followed by games against BYU, Texas Tech and Houston in the closing stretch. The source did not provide a confirmed timetable for Lagway’s return.
